General Condition Standards
Most reputable resellers adhere to a set of general condition standards that categorize the state of the item. These standards typically include:
- New: Items that are unused, unopened, and in original packaging.
- Like New: Slightly used items with no visible signs of wear.
- Excellent: Items with minor signs of use but no significant damage.
- Very Good: Items showing some wear but fully functional and intact.
- Good: Items with noticeable signs of use or minor cosmetic damage but still operational.
- Acceptable: Items with significant wear or damage, often with functional issues.
Specific Standards for Electronics
Electronics resellers follow additional detailed standards to ensure functionality and safety. These include:
- Functionality: All features and functions must work properly.
- Cosmetic Condition: No cracks, deep scratches, or missing parts unless specified.
- Battery Life: Batteries should hold a charge and be in good condition.
- Accessories: Original accessories and packaging are often required for higher standards.
- Testing: Items are tested to ensure they meet operational standards.
Standards for Collectibles and Luxury Goods
For collectibles and luxury items, condition standards are even more specific. Reputable resellers look for:
- Authenticity: Proven authenticity with certificates or provenance.
- Physical Condition: No significant damage, tears, or discoloration.
- Completeness: Original packaging, tags, or accessories included.
- Restoration: No signs of unauthorized restoration or repairs.
- Documentation: Proper documentation supporting the item’s history and condition.
